REYNOLDS AMERICAN has an exciting opportunity for a Manager HRBP in Winston Salem, NC

Requirements

  • Data Management & Accuracy: Skilled in maintaining precise data across HR systems (HRIS, leave & claims, case management) and tools like Excel, PowerPoint, PowerBI.
  • Strategic Thinking & Collaboration: Ability to see the bigger picture, apply context, and influence stakeholders at all levels while fostering strong partnerships.
  • Analytical & Curious Mindset: Naturally seeks to understand the "why" behind decisions and data, using insights to drive meaningful actions.
  • Experience & Education: Bachelor's degree in business or HR with 2-3 years as HR Business Partner/Generalist; adept in process-driven environments with competing priorities.
  • Leadership & Communication Skills: Confident, self-driven, credible, and skilled at delivering coaching and guidance to diverse audiences; SAP SuccessFactors experience is a plus.

Nice To Haves

  • SAP SuccessFactors experience is a plus.

Responsibilities

  • Supporting assigned functional managers, in areas including but not limited to recruiting, employee moves, compensation, and cyclical processes, as both a process expert and liaison with internal HR COE partners
  • Proactively owning real-time data monitoring, input, and maintenance for designated Corporate functions, ensuring data accuracy and integrity across HR systems, organizational charts, functional spreadsheets, and Headcount/Total Employment Cost processes
  • Serving as the primary point of contact for employee inquiries related to benefits, leaves, and HR policies, ensuring timely and accurate resolution and adherence to policy
  • Supporting cyclical HR processes such as performance reviews, compensation cycles, and talent management initiatives in partnership with HR COEs
  • Supporting the full-cycle recruitment process of functional and Early Careers roles through strong partnership with Talent Acquisition, ensuring roles are filled with speed and quality talent

Benefits

  • 401(k) plan that offers opportunity to save on pre- and post-tax basis up to 50 percent of eligible compensation.
  • Company matches 100 percent of employee pre-tax/Roth (401k) contributions up to six percent
  • Company contributes an additional three percent to 401(k) whether employee participates or not
  • Comprehensive health- and welfare-benefits package (including medical, dental, vision, and prescription drugs)
  • Health Savings Account start-up contribution for employees who elect the high deductible health plan
  • Flexible spending accounts for both Health Care and Dependent Care allowing employee to use pre-tax dollars to pay for qualified expenses during the calendar year
  • Employee assistance program offering 8 free counselling sessions, per issue, each calendar year for employees and their dependents
  • Company paid life insurance of 1x annual base pay ($50,000 minimum)
  • Company paid accidental death or dismemberment insurance of 2x annual base pay ($50,000 minimum)
  • Voluntary insurances offered at group rates: employee and dependent life insurance, AD&D insurance, critical illness, accident coverage, disability buy-up, and auto & home insurance
  • Tuition reimbursement and student loan support
  • Dependent Scholarship Programs
  • Free confidential personal financial counselling service
  • On-site health centers and 24/7 fitness centers at certain company locations
  • A charitable giving matching grants program that enables employees to direct and double their donations to qualifying charitable organizations of their choice
  • Health-care concierge service
  • Volunteer service opportunities
  • Extensive training opportunities
  • Company vehicle for eligible employees
  • Mobile phone allowance for eligible employees
  • Sick and Personal Time (exempt employees may be excused with pay for brief absences; non-exempt employees receive up to 6 days)
  • Vacation (levels Below Senior Director receive 15 days (pro-rated during first year of service); Senior Director and Officers receive 25 days (pro-rated during first year of service)).
  • Holidays (Nine company recognized and two annual personal holidays to be used at the employee's discretion)
  • Paid Parental Leave + temporary reduced work schedule opportunity
  • Funeral Leave
  • Short-Term Disability Leave
  • Long-Term Disability Leave
  • Jury Duty Leave
  • Military Leave
  • Released Time for Children's Education
  • Community Outreach Leave
  • Other paid leave benefits, as required by state or local law
